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wich with Honey Bliss Ingredients

For the Chicken

  • 4 pieces Chicken Breasts (boneless and skinless) – Use fresh for the best flavor and texture in your sandwich.
  • 1 cup Buttermilk (for marinating) – This tenderizes the chicken, making it juicy and flavorful.
  • 1 cup Flour (for coating) – A light coating helps achieve that perfect crispy crust when baked.
  • 2 tablespoons Cayenne Pepper (for spice) – Adjust based on your heat preference for the ultimate spicy kick.

For the Honey Glaze

  • 1/2 cup Honey (for sweetness) – This balances the heat, creating a delightful flavor contrast in your sandwich.
  • 1 tablespoon Hot Sauce (for additional heat) – Choose your favorite brand to enhance the spiciness of the glaze.

For the Sandwich Assembly

  • 4 pieces Buns (for serving) – Soft, toasted buns hold everything together beautifully while adding a comforting touch.
  • 4 slices Pickles (for topping) – Add tanginess that complements the sweet and spicy flavors of the chicken.

How to Make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wich with Honey Bliss

1. Marinate the chicken breasts in buttermilk for at least 1 hour. This step infuses the chicken with moisture and flavor, ensuring a tender and juicy bite later on.

2.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). This temperature is essential for achieving that crispy golden crust on your chicken, giving it the perfect bake.

3. Coat the marinated chicken in a mixture of flour and cayenne pepper. The flour will create a delightful crunch, while the cayenne adds that signature spicy kick, preparing your taste buds for a treat!

4. Place the coated chicken on a baking sheet and bake for 25-30 minutes until cooked through. Look for a beautiful golden color and an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C) to ensure it’s perfectly done.

5. Mix honey and hot sauce in a bowl until well combined. This sweet and spicy glaze is what ties everything together, creating that irresistible flavor we crave in each bite.

6. Drizzle your finished chicken with the honey glaze and serve it on buns with pickles. The contrast of heat from the chicken and the sweetness of honey bliss is simply divine!

How to Store and Freeze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wich with Honey Bliss

  • Fridge: Store leftover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wich with Honey Bliss in an airtight container for up to 3 days. This keeps the chicken moist and flavorful.
  • Freezer: If you want to enjoy it later, freeze the chicken separately from the buns and toppings for up to 2 months. Wrap tightly in plastic wrap and foil.
  • Reheating: For best results, reheat the chicken in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until warmed through, about 15-20 minutes. Avoid microwaving to keep it crispy.
  • Buns: Keep leftover buns in a sealed bag at room temperature for up to 2 days. For longer storage, freeze them as well and toast when ready to serve.

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wich with Honey Bliss Recipe FAQs

How long should I marinate the chicken breasts in buttermilk?

Marinate the chicken breasts for at least 1 hour in buttermilk. This step is crucial as it tenderizes the meat and infuses it with moisture, ensuring a juicy bite after baking.

What can I use if I don’t have buttermilk?

If you find yourself without buttermilk, don’t worry! You can create a quick substitute by mixing 1 cup of milk with 1 tablespoon of vinegar or lemon juice. Let it sit for about 5-10 minutes to thicken slightly before using it to marinate your chicken.

Can I store leftovers of this sandwich?

Absolutely! If you have any leftover Spicy Baked Nashville Hot Chicken Sandwiches,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Just remember to keep the components separate (chicken, buns, pickles) to maintain their textures.

Is it possible to freeze the chicken before baking?

Yes, you can freeze the coated chicken before baking! Wrap each piece t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They’ll keep well for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to cook, just thaw them overnight in the refrigerator and bake as directed.

What if my chicken isn’t crispy after baking?

If your chicken isn’t crispy enough after baking for 25-30 minutes, you can try broiling it for an additional 2-3 minutes. Keep a close eye on it during this time to avoid burning — you want that perfect golden crust!
